Transaction 67c89096ccabc30aab522d4d18780614fb689f820fad7864080f26691faf0741
1 Input
1 Output
-
67c89096ccabc30aab522d4d18780614fb689f820fad7864080f26691faf0741:0
- value
- 808858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a65bebd295cb3101729c44c112a394f9c2c51f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dcn8qy7HSK3JFRzG7uZWaTdJSHUWpPYTe